Ossining Man Arrested For Driving Without License In Yorktown
He was initially pulled over for driving with an obstructed view, police said.

OSSINING, NY — An Ossining man was arrested after being stopped for allegedly driving a car with an obstructed view. Yorktown police said Brandon S. Duran, 19, of Ossining, was charged with second-degree aggravated unlicensed operation, a misdemeanor, and obstructed view, a traffic infraction.
A police officer on patrol around 11:54 p.m. Aug. 26 in the area of Spring Valley Road saw that the vehicle being driven by Duran had a view that was obstructed.
After being pulled over, a computer check found that Duran’s driving privilege in New York had been suspended on multiple dates for failure to pay a fine and failure to answer a summons.

He was arrested and taken to police headquarters where he was processed and released on $100 bail.
Duran is scheduled to answer the charges in Yorktown Justice Court Sept. 27.
